Quarterly Planning Note — FX Hedging

For Q2, Dunmore Trading will hedge 70% of projected receivables in the Valtian crown, up from 55% last quarter. Recent volatility against our base currency has eroded branch margins, particularly at Kestrel Bay and Ormund. Forward contracts will be arranged centrally by the treasury desk; branches should not enter local arrangements. Margin targets remain unchanged. The rationale tied to our broader plans is summarised in the note below.

board note of kageg-bahof: The renewal with Holwynax Holdings closes at $2 million a year, 5 percent below the last contract. Project Ulaath slips by two quarters because of the supplier delay.

Warranty claims on the Ardent 300 series have exceeded forecast by 34% this half, driven chiefly by premature seal failures in units shipped from the Lowmere plant between March and June. Branch managers should route affected claims through the expedited track and avoid committing to replacement timelines beyond ten working days. A redesigned seal enters production next quarter. Financial exposure and remediation plans remain confidential. The broader implications are summarised in the note below.

board note of bawep-tajef: Queniusek Systems plans to raise the Quenvan list price by 53.1 percent in March. The pricing group signed off on a budget of $176.4 million for Project Drueth. The renewal with Casionix Partners closes at $142.5 million a year, 8.3 percent below the last contract. Project Fraax slips by six weeks because of the tooling delay.

// BASELINE_PATH points to the static-analysis baseline file for the Kestrelworks
// scanner. The baseline suppresses known, triaged findings so new code is held
// to a clean standard without forcing a full legacy cleanup. Do not edit the
// baseline by hand; regenerate it with the refresh script and commit the result
// in its own change. The baseline is tied to the scanner build noted below.

trace token, fafog-kageg: htk4_98e6